Kinds of Driver's Licenses in Spain
Before diving into the application process, it's necessary to comprehend the various kinds of motorist's licenses readily available in Spain:
License TypeDescriptionCredibility PeriodClass B LicenseEnables you to drive automobiles and vans weighing approximately 3,500 kgTen yearsClass A LicenseFor motorbikes; varies by engine capacity10 yearsClass C LicenseFor driving trucks over 3,500 kg5 yearsClass D LicenseFor driving buses5 yearsClass BE LicenseAllows you to tow a trailer over 750 kg10 years
A lot of individuals seeking to drive automobiles will pursue the Class B license, making it the focus of this guide.

2. Take a Medical Exam
Go to an authorized medical center to obtain the required medical certificate. This exam will normally assess your eyesight, hearing, and general health to guarantee you're fit to drive.
3. Research study for the Theoretical Test
Prepare for the theoretical test utilizing research study materials provided by your driving school or resources available online. There are various practice tests available that can assist familiarize you with the format of the test.
4. Pass the Theoretical Test
Once you feel ready, arrange your theoretical exam at the nearest DGT office. The test will include multiple-choice questions about traffic rules, security regulations, and road signs.
5. Complete Practical Driving Lessons
When you pass the theoretical test, start taking practical driving lessons, focusing on different driving maneuvers, parking, and road awareness. Driving schools typically use plans of lessons that prepare you for the useful test.
6. Pass the Practical Test
After finishing your lessons and sensation confident in your driving capabilities, you can schedule your practical driving test. During the test, an inspector will evaluate your driving abilities, including adherence to traffic laws and capability to handle different driving circumstances.
7. Obtain Your Driver's License
Upon passing both the theoretical and dry runs, you'll get a provisional license. After a probationary period and fulfilling any additional requirements, [Comprar Un Permiso De Conducir Español Oficial](https://pad.stuve.de/s/URsB4eids) you'll obtain a complete motorist's license.
Extra Costs
When considering the overall expense of obtaining a motorist's license in Spain, anticipate the following expenditures:
ItemApproximated Cost (EUR)Driving School Fees600 - 1,500Theoretical Test30 - 50Dry run60 - 100Medical Certificate30 - 50DGT Processing Fee10 - 30
Overall Estimated Cost: EUR800 - EUR1,800
Timeframe
The time it requires to obtain a motorist's license in Spain differs. Usually, applicants might anticipate the process to take anywhere from a few months to over a year, primarily depending on their availability for lessons and [Comprar Un Permiso De Conducir Español Oficial](https://posteezy.com/most-valuable-advice-you-can-ever-receive-about-buy-real-european-drivers-license) test scheduling.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I drive in Spain with a foreign driver's license?
Yes, you can drive in Spain with a valid foreign driver's license for approximately 6 months. After this duration, you need to obtain a Spanish license.
2. What if I currently have a driver's license from another EU nation?
If you have a valid motorist's license from another EU country, you can use it in Spain without requiring to transform it.
3. The length of time is the medical certificate valid?
The medical certificate is typically valid for three months from the date of issuance.
4. What takes place if I stop working the theoretical or useful test?
If you fail either test, you can reattempt them after a waiting duration. The waiting duration generally varies from 15 days to 2 months, depending upon the particular requirements and regulations of the DGT.
5. Are there any age constraints for other categories of licenses?
Yes, different classifications of licenses have various minimum age requirements. For example, Class A licenses for motorcycles require the applicant to be a minimum of 20 years old.
